From e7e8bd8af341719b7cb902c7861ea198f5db43a6 Mon Sep 17 00:00:00 2001
From: Robbert Noordzij <robbert@xseeding.nl>
Date: Tue, 07 Oct 2014 06:14:27 -0400
Subject: [PATCH] Bug in the rawservlet in extracting the repository out of the path. The offset for finding the next slash should be the current slash + 1, not the last offset + the offset of the current slash.
---
src/test/java/com/gitblit/tests/ArrayUtilsTest.java | 15 ++++++---------
1 files changed, 6 insertions(+), 9 deletions(-)
diff --git a/src/test/java/com/gitblit/tests/ArrayUtilsTest.java b/src/test/java/com/gitblit/tests/ArrayUtilsTest.java
index 8a38afb..9308978 100644
--- a/src/test/java/com/gitblit/tests/ArrayUtilsTest.java
+++ b/src/test/java/com/gitblit/tests/ArrayUtilsTest.java
@@ -15,9 +15,6 @@
*/
package com.gitblit.tests;
-import static org.junit.Assert.assertFalse;
-import static org.junit.Assert.assertTrue;
-
import java.util.ArrayList;
import java.util.Arrays;
import java.util.HashSet;
@@ -28,7 +25,7 @@
import com.gitblit.utils.ArrayUtils;
-public class ArrayUtilsTest {
+public class ArrayUtilsTest extends GitblitUnitTest {
@Test
public void testArrays() {
@@ -37,10 +34,10 @@
Object [] emptyArray = new Object[0];
assertTrue(ArrayUtils.isEmpty(emptyArray));
-
+
assertFalse(ArrayUtils.isEmpty(new String [] { "" }));
}
-
+
@Test
public void testLists() {
List<?> nullList = null;
@@ -48,11 +45,11 @@
List<?> emptyList = new ArrayList<Object>();
assertTrue(ArrayUtils.isEmpty(emptyList));
-
+
List<?> list = Arrays.asList("");
assertFalse(ArrayUtils.isEmpty(list));
}
-
+
@Test
public void testSets() {
Set<?> nullSet = null;
@@ -60,7 +57,7 @@
Set<?> emptySet = new HashSet<Object>();
assertTrue(ArrayUtils.isEmpty(emptySet));
-
+
Set<?> set = new HashSet<Object>(Arrays.asList(""));
assertFalse(ArrayUtils.isEmpty(set));
}
--
Gitblit v1.9.1